VNQ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

1,189 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Real Estate ETF (VNQ)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$20.1B — up 2.7% from $19.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 89 funds opened new VNQ positions and 60 closed out — a net gain of 29 holders — while 506 added to existing stakes and 434 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$220M. The largest seller was Barclays, cutting an estimated $122M.
